Embrace awkward / This is not a fraternity

There's likely never going to be any career building connections within Samson Society because the group of men you will find yourself rubbing shoulders with weekly aren't there to further their ambitions, nor are they there to serve their community or church through that particular venue.  It's simply not opportunistic in that regard.

Samson Society is about brokenness.  It's men who've often times been crushed by life's circumstances, therefore despite their attempts to fulfill their emotional needs through other means, they've been unsuccessful and from there, their lives have suffered.

Men coming together and admitting that they need a place to be authentic - for at least a few hours a week - results in some very nontraditional dialogue / vibes.  And within that setting, everything's kept within strictest confidence.

It may sound like a company of Christian men who are simply the outcasts of the church.  Perhaps those who simply can't seem to "fit in" within the traditional setting.

And perhaps there's some truth to that statement.

Nonetheless, every man needs to find his place.  Whether it's Samson Society, Sunday School, or Rotary Club, know that you were not created to follow Christ outside of some semblance of community.  Community that works to challenge and accept you fully - each time you walk through the door.
